Why Silicon Oasis Is a Unique Rental Market

Dubai Silicon Oasis (DSO) isn’t your average neighbourhood. It’s a free zone, a technology hub, and a residential community all at once. That mix creates a specific kind of demand that most rental companies aren’t set up to meet properly.

You’ve got tech professionals commuting daily to Business Bay or DIFC. You’ve got families settled in the villas and apartments who need a second car for school runs and supermarket trips. You’ve got short-term contractors flying in for project stints. All of them need the same thing: a reliable car hire in Dubai Silicon Oasis that doesn’t require a week of paperwork and a dozen phone calls.

The location itself also matters practically. Silicon Oasis sits along the Al Ain Road (E66), which makes it a natural launchpad for trips to Deira, the airport, Downtown, or even a weekend drive to Abu Dhabi. A good rental from here gives you the whole city — and beyond.

Common Questions About Renting in Silicon Oasis

Do I need a UAE driving licence to rent a car? UAE residents need a valid UAE driving licence. Tourists can drive with their home country licence for a short period, but an International Driving Permit (IDP) is advisable for stays beyond a few weeks.

Is insurance included? It depends on the provider, but reputable rental companies include basic insurance as standard. Always confirm what level of cover is included and whether there’s an option to add comprehensive coverage.

Can I rent a car without a credit card? Most companies require a credit card for the security deposit, though some accept debit cards with proof of residence. Confirm this directly with the provider before booking.

What’s the minimum rental age in Dubai? Generally, 21 years old, though some luxury vehicle categories may require drivers to be 25 or older.

Getting the Best Deal on Your Next Rental

There are a few things that reliably lower your final cost, regardless of which provider you choose:

           Book in advance — Last-minute bookings during peak periods almost always cost more.

           Opt for a monthly plan if your stay exceeds three weeks. The daily rate is considerably lower.

           Check what’s included before comparing prices. A slightly higher quote that includes insurance and Salik registration is often cheaper than a lower quote that doesn’t.

           Ask about loyalty rates — If you rent regularly, most local companies will offer returning customer pricing.
